Minnesota is home to some very cool winters, so when the weather warms up, there's plenty of reasons for folks from Minneapolis apartments to celebrate, and where better to celebrate than in the gorgeous waters of Lake Harriet? This splendid lake is home to a number of fun amenities, but of course the main reason people take to these waters is to take in the sun and fun of the Minneapolis summertime. When the summer hits, an apartment near Lake Harriet becomes one of the hottest commodities in town, allowing you access to all the fun of the lake without having to stray far from your own front door. The cool waters of Lake Harriet draw out plenty of good-looking young folks when the warmer weather arrives, creating fantastic opportunities for people-watching along the waves. Aquatic fun of all sorts is also available, with rentals for boats, jet skis and more available, letting you take to the water whenever you like. The lake is also home to numerous hike-and-bike trails, meaning those with apartments near Lake Harriet can stay fit while taking all the beauty the lake has to offer. Lake Harriet is also home to a number of concerts during the summer at its well-designed band shell, letting you experience the arts and experience all the fun of the lake all in the same day. Lake Harriet would be a fantastic spot to visit on its own, but with all the attractions and amenities around it, there's simply no reason why a person from a Minneapolis apartment wouldn't give the spot a visit. An apartment near Lake Harriet will provides one with all the benefits of a day on the lake, without the major trip out, which makes it one of the best spots in town.
Frequently Asked Questions about Minneapolis
How much are Studio apartments in Minneapolis?
There are currently 2,377 Studio Apartments in Minneapolis with rent ranges from $640 to $2,580 with an average price of $1,317.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Minneapolis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Minneapolis ranges from $500 to $8,819 with an average monthly rent of $1,602.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Minneapolis c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Minneapolis range from $469 to $15,685.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,195.
How expensive are Minneapolis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 669 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Minneapolis on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$739 to $14,500 - averaging $2,614 for the location.
